What to Look For in the Best Kids Drum Kit
Before you add to cart, there are a few key things to consider to make sure the drum kit you choose is fun, functional, and age-appropriate.
1. Age Suitability
Different age groups have different needs:
- Ages 3â5: Look for toddler-sized kits with fewer pieces and lots of colour. They should be lightweight, safe, and easy to play.
- Ages 6â10: Beginner sets with snare, toms, and cymbals will offer a more realistic experience while still being manageable.
- Ages 10+: At this stage, you can start introducing more advanced sets, including full-size kits, depending on skill level and interest.
2. Drum Kit Components
A typical drum kit includes:
- Snare drum
- Bass drum (with pedal)
- Toms
- Hi-hat cymbals
- Crash/ride cymbal
- Drum stool
- Drumsticks
The more pieces, the more complex and exciting the setupâbut make sure itâs appropriate for your childâs age and size.
3. Electric vs. Acoustic
- Electric kits are quieter, allow for headphone practice, and often have digital learning features.
- Acoustic kits offer a traditional drumming experience with fuller, real-time soundâbut they can be loud.
4. Durability & Safety
Kids are passionateâbut also rough. Look for:
- Solid hardware
- Child-safe materials (no sharp edges or small detachable parts)
- Stable stool and adjustable stands
5. Size & Space
Measure your space. Drum kits take up room. If youâre short on space, look for compact or foldable kits.

How to Choose the Right Drum Kit Based on Age
Choosing the right kit by age can make a huge difference in how your child learns and enjoys the instrument.
Ages 3â5
- Toy-style drum sets or mini acoustic kits
- Keep it simpleâ1â3 drums max
- Lightweight, durable materials
Ages 6â9
- Full beginner drum sets (3â5 pieces)
- Option to go electric for quieter play
- Focus on adjustable height and comfort
Ages 10+
- Junior versions of full drum kits
- More complex arrangements and deeper tones
- Durable enough for lessons, rehearsals, or performances
Pro Tip: As your child grows, look for expandable kits that can be upgraded with new toms, cymbals, or electronic modules.

FAQs
1. What age can a child start using a drum kit?
Children as young as 3 can start with toddler-sized kits or toy drum sets. By age 5â6, theyâre ready for real beginner kitsâacoustic or electric.
2. Are electric or acoustic kits better for beginners?
Electric kits are quieter and often include learning tools, making them great for home practice. Acoustic kits offer a more authentic feel and sound, ideal for those taking formal lessons.
3. How much should I spend on a beginner drum kit?
Expect to spend between $100â$500 AUD for a solid beginner kit. Budget options are great for testing interest, while premium kits offer long-term use and upgrade potential.
4. Are kids drum kits loud?
Acoustic kits are loudâno getting around it. Electric kits offer volume control and headphones for quiet practice, perfect for shared living spaces.
5. Can drum kits grow with your child?
Yes. Many kits are adjustable or expandable, especially those aimed at ages 6+. Look for durable materials, adjustable stools, and kits that can evolve with skill level.
